如何将EXCEL中的日期格式转换成数值型格式

发布网友 发布时间:2022-02-25 02:26

我来回答

6个回答

热心网友 时间:2022-02-25 03:56

材料/工具:Excel2010

1、如本例A列中列示了一列日期,要求将A列中的日期转换为数值,结果在B列显示。

2、首先我们将A2单元格的日期先进行转换,选中B2单元格,在单元格中输入运算符号=,然后点击【fx】按钮。

3、弹出【插入函数】对话框:在【或选择类别】中选择[全部]选项;在【选择函数】中选择函数[VALUE],这个函数可以将一个代表数值的文本字符串转换成数值。选择好函数后,点击【确定】按钮。

4、通过上一步骤的操作,弹出【函数参数】对话框,在空白对话框中直接选中表格中的A2单元格,即转换日期所在单元格。参数设置好后,点击【确定】按钮。

5、返回到工作表中,通过以上操作步骤,A2单元格的日期就转换为了数值格式。

6、选中B2单元格,点击鼠标左键拖动鼠标将B2单元格的公式予以复制。这样,A列中所列示的日期就转换为了数值格式。

热心网友 时间:2022-02-25 05:14

要想将这样的日期转换成年月的数值型格式,需要使用公式转换,转换后再另存为数值。

1、在日期型数据的右边一格B1单元格输入公式:

=--TEXT(A1,"emm")

2、复制B1单元格,单击A1单元格,单击鼠标右键,再单击选择性粘贴

3、在弹出的选择性粘贴对话框中单击数值,再单击确定

4、选择A1单元格,按快捷键CTRL+1,弹出设置单元格格式对话框,单击数字选项卡,在分类列表框单击常规按钮,再单击确定即可。

热心网友 时间:2022-02-25 06:48

这样就是数值了
=(YEAR(A1)&TEXT(MONTH(A1),"00"))*1

一楼的回答是正确的,如果只是为了显示就没有问题! 如果要换成真正的数值,就用我这个公式

热心网友 时间:2022-02-25 08:40

这是不可能的,要从日期型转换成数值型就是一个换算过程,他换算的公式不可能换出你原来的数字
我想知道你为什么要这样换格式

热心网友 时间:2022-02-25 10:48

选中日期所在的单元格区域-》鼠标右键-》设置单元格格式-》自定义,在右面的“类型”框内输入:
yyyymm
即可。

补充:
可分步完成:
1、假如日期在A1,可以在B1中输入:
=--TEXT(A1,"yyyymm")
2、复制B1-》选中A1-》鼠标右键-》选择性粘贴-》数值-》确定
3、删除B1完成操作
(注意将A1设为常规或数值格式)

热心网友 时间:2022-02-25 13:12

=TEXT(YEAR(A1),0)&TEXT(MONTH(A1),"00")
声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。
E-MAIL:11247931@qq.com